Columbian-based label, From A Lost Place is no stranger to us here at Delayed. Since 2018 the imprint run by founder, Launaea has been a consistent presence in the ambient, deep and experimental musical worlds that we are so fond of. With past releases including notable names like Zemög, Claudio PRC, Launaea himself, and a few monster compilations, there’s something for everyone in their rich backlog.
Marking a new direction for the label, the latest forthcoming release, titled ‘parasympathetic’ finds us listening to a glittering five tracker by the German artist, YYARD. Bright melodies abound as the label states, ‘perfect definition of the artist's eclecticism, blending groove and jazz influences with very meticulous rhythms, rich and organic percussions perfectly suited for the dance floor’.
'apnoe', the second to final track on the release, takes a darker approach, compared to the emotional highs of, say, Endless Summers. A full-sounding synth lead takes center stage as it grows and grows, while snappy percussion plays throughout, providing that proper groove and infectious movement. Tracks like these are ear worms and proper for a warmup session.
'apnoe', and in turn ‘parasympathetic’ will be released on November 20th.

The night had turned cold by the time Camu began, but inside La Cabaña, everything felt suspended: warm light, still bodies, a low hum stretching through wood and pine. People settled into corners, wrapped in layers, quieted by the vibration that marked the start. The music felt transmitted, its slow-moving drones drifting through the wooden walls and into the forest beyond. The sound rolled out like fog under moonlight, patient, opaque, its motion too subtle to measure. It was music to dissolve into.
Minutes became air. The cabin started to tremble. Camu’s sense of space was uncanny, each drone a line drawn in mist, each pause a small release of gravity. Later came the fragments: field recordings, faint acapellas, echoes of the forest replayed from another world. By then, the cabin no longer felt grounded. It was a stationary vessel, hovering somewhere between the trees and the stars, surrounded by invisible energy. Somewhere, just beyond the clearing, Pablo’s bass murmured like thunder in a parallel world. When silence finally returned, it wasn’t emptiness; it was the echo of what had passed through.
